Pastor Balogun, who was moved from Region 21, Oyo State, made the plea in his speech at the welcome service organised by the Region in his honour, and that of the Assistant Pastor in Charge of the region (APICR), Pastor Bode Rotimi Olojede, at the regional headquarters, Trinity Sanctuary Parish, Benin City.
“Now that the headquarters of the Almighty God has shifted to Benin City, the land filled with honey and greater opportunities, I would like to announce that our season of multiplication has started, and we are going to witness an all-round multiplication spiritually, physically, financially, socially and we shall be a model to others. In enjoying the multiplication, our guiding principle shall be Service, Integrity and Accountability (SIA),” he stated.
“SIA summarises the guiding principles of our work. Service to God means we will be committed to the principles of God without compromising holiness. Service to people means we would be involved in aggressive evangelism, so as to bring souls into the kingdom of God. But, in doing that, we will embark on Corporate Social Responsibility service, which is part of the strategies. Personal evangelism and welfare schemes are also part of the strategies,” he stated.
